References to Manuals & Procedures
White Ladder Aviation operates under a full suite of FAA-accepted manuals governing our maintenance and inspection activities, including our Repair Station & Quality Control Manual (RSQCM), Training Program Manual, Forms Manual, and NDT Written Practice. These documents define our procedures for receiving, inspection, NDT processes, equipment control, return-to-service, training, calibration, and recordkeeping.
While these manuals are controlled documents and not published publicly, WLA makes relevant procedural information available to customers and FAA inspectors upon request and maintains all documentation in accordance with 14 CFR Part 145 and applicable ASTM standards.
Certifications, Approvals & Standards Followed
White Ladder Aviation operates as an FAA-certificated Part 145 Repair Station (certificate in process, issuance expected in early 2026) and performs nondestructive testing in accordance with established industry and regulatory standards. Our inspections and procedures follow:
14 CFR Part 145
FAA Repair Station Regulations
ASTM E1417/E1417M
Standard Practice for Liquid Penetrant Testing
ASTM E165
Penetrant Inspection Materials & Processes
NAS 410
Qualification & Certification of Nondestructive Testing Personnel
